Ryujinx primarily uses and .XCI file formats for games. While these are the most common, the emulator also supports several other technical file types essential for running, updating, and decrypting software. Supported Game File Formats

As of October 1, 2024, Ryujinx development has officially after its creator was contacted by Nintendo. While the project's GitHub and assets were removed, existing installations still function using the file formats listed above.
